Are you energized by leadership, education, and development of partnerships with key External Experts and Professional Bodies? If so, this Field Based Medical Science Liaison role could be an ideal opportunity to explore.Job Territory : Field Based Medical Science Liaison, you will be responsible for execution of the external engagement strategy aligned to the therapeutic portfolio, as well as implementation of the external engagement plan aligned to Therapy area strategies, driving a consistent approach to carrying out engagement activities in the field.The territory will cover the following US geographic area : CO-UT-NV-NM.This role will provide YOU the opportunity to lead key activities to progress YOUR career, these responsibilities include some of the following…Work with medical colleagues and other business partners to identify External Experts, professional groups, decision makers and other key stakeholders in the assigned therapy area and or geography.Respond compliantly to unsolicited information requests from healthcare professionals and associated individuals regarding licensed or un-licensed GSK medicines and indications; ensure all medical information responses are factual, fair and balanced, scientifically rigorous and strictly comply with GSK standards and policies and with local codes of practice, guidelines and laws.Disseminate important safety information to the healthcare profession as directed by the Medical Affairs or Research and Development teams or the Dear Healthcare Provider Letter (DHPL) process.Deliver Non-Promotional Scientific Discussions (NPSD) for a GSK medicine that is on label or consistent with the label to inform and educate HCPs on the appropriate use of our medicines in patients.Maintain expertise in the evolving scientific / therapeutic area and in competitor medicines and vaccines.Attend and contribute (if required) to medical portion of regional account planning / training sessions.Attend both national and regional scientific / medical meetings to gain medical voice of the customer on recent data being presented on products and disease states of interest to GSK.Support clinical development activities and programs including GSK and Investigator sponsored studies as well as collaborating with R&D staff to improve site performance.Conduct individual discussions and meetings with steering committee members, advisory board members, consultants etc., on topics related to the work being conducted with GSK.Provide scientific training for GSK sales representatives regarding GSK products and the conditions they treat utilizing approved Sales Training materials.Partner with matrix colleagues (e.g., sales, marketing, market access, etc.) to ensure strategies and business plans are both patient and business focused, and adding value to the external expert.Basic Qualifications : Pharm. D or Ph. D, DNP, or MD (with a medical or clinical focus).Two years' experience in pharmacology and pharmacotherapy in humans and has applied this experience in a clinical setting.Must live within territory specified.Preferred Qualifications : Residency of Post-Doctoral training in a clinical / pharmaceutical practice setting.Pharmaceutical industry experience or medical liaison experience, with Immuno-Inflammation therapeutic a plus.Previous clinical experience in situations where direct / or indirect decision-making authority for patient care was demonstrated.Above average computer literacy, including experience with software applications.The annual base salary for new hires in this position ranges from $164,900 to $223,100 taking into account a number of factors including work location, the candidate’s skills, experience, education level and the market rate for the role. In addition, this position offers an annual bonus and eligibility to participate in our share based long term incentive program which is dependent on the level of the role.
